Cryotherapy is a treatment that uses extreme cold to help heal and stimulate the body’s cells. It can also be used to reduce inflammation and improve blood circulation. In addition, it can relieve muscle pain and aid in weight loss. In some cases, it can treat certain types of cancers. However, more research is needed to confirm the effectiveness of Cryotherapy.

There are many ways to perform Cryotherapy, including a spot freeze, a timed freeze-thaw technique, and carbon dioxide snow therapy. Each method has different benefits and risks. It is important to be aware of these risks before trying this treatment. A doctor should perform the procedure if it is necessary for your health.

Spot freeze cryotherapy uses a spray gun to cover the skin lesion with liquid nitrogen. After the procedure, the area will be red and may swell, but it shouldn’t break or leak. The treated area will probably heal in seven to 10 days. Washing the area daily with fragrance-free soap and water would be best. You should also avoid putting the area on direct heat.

Nutritional counseling is a treatment that helps individuals improve their health and well-being by changing their current eating habits. Its focus is to reduce the amount of unhealthy food consumed and to increase the consumption of healthy food. It can also help you learn how to moderate your portion sizes and make healthier choices.

A nutritional counselor will study your eating patterns and habits to determine what changes must be made. They will consider your medical history and lifestyle to find a solution that suits you. They may help you to widen your range of meals by suggesting different textures and flavors. They can also teach you to prepare food and drink beverages correctly.

A good nutritional counselor will set behavior-oriented goals rather than absolute values like body weight. For example, a client who wants to prevent weight gain from medications will be encouraged to increase the consumption of fruits and vegetables while reducing junk food. They will also use daily food records to analyze energy and nutrient intake.

The water damage restoration process is complex and requires a lot of expertise. This is why working with an IICRC-certified water damage restoration company is a good idea. They’ll be able to provide thorough and effective services and use the latest technology and equipment to ensure your home is restored to its original state. They’ll also be able to help you navigate the insurance claims process if necessary.

If the water damage impacts any objects or structures, they must be removed and replaced. This includes drywall, carpeting, and any other permanent materials that were affected. It is important to return these items because they can become weakened or moldy over time. If a structure is compromised, it could be unsafe for you and cause additional issues, such as structural damage and water leaks.

After removing the excess water and drying out the area, you can start working on the restoration process. This will include any cleaning, sanitizing, or deodorizing necessary for the area. Restoration experts will use specialized equipment to complete the job faster and more effectively. They will also use moisture meters to evaluate the area and ensure it has been properly dried.

If a flood or other natural disaster caused water damage, they would also take steps to protect your home from further damage and to prevent further flooding. This could involve boarding up windows or putting down tarps. Doing these things before starting the water damage restoration process is important because it will help prevent further damage and minimize repair costs.

Once the restoration is complete, your home will be restored to its original condition. Any damaged materials will be repaired or replaced, and any contaminated areas will be cleaned and disinfected. This will help to prevent future problems such as mold and mildew growth, structural damage, and other health hazards.

While you can do some water damage restoration yourself, leaving the bigger jobs to the professionals is always best. If you are dealing with significant flooding, a serious leak, or a large amount of sewage, it is essential to call in the experts to avoid further damage and potential health risks. You should only attempt a DIY water damage restoration if it is safe to do so and if you are experienced with such projects. It is also important to have the proper equipment, such as a wet/dry shop vac and dehumidifiers, to help you with the process.
